Comment libérer de la mémoire ?
Bonjour,
J'interviens en maintenance sur une application de plusieurs miliers de lignes en VBA Excel 8-) qui fait des traitements sur de grosses feuilles de données.
Certaines instructions à répétition ont tendance à occuper de la mémoire sans la libérer (je le vois en regardant l'uilisation de la mémoire avec le gestionnaire des tâches de Windows). Typiquement il s'agit d'instructions d'insertions ou de suppression de lignes, ou alors des requêtes sql qui peuvent charger la mémoire de 10Mo d'un coup lors du Refresh.
Evidemment, plus la mémoire est occupée, plus le traitement est ralenti :mouarf:
Ma question : comment libérer de la mémoire réservée par Excel lors de l'exécution de ce code ?
Merci